Persistent file-based planning for multi-step AI-agent work. Keeps task_plan.md, findings.md, and progress.md on disk; Kiro skill instructions and steering state read selected project planning context. Recovery reads project planning files and their timestamps only, not agent transcript stores. This adapter registers no Stop hook, never requests continuation, and never runs commands declared in Markdown. The skill has no network upload path. Use for research or work needing 5+ tool calls.

Debug LangChain and LangGraph agents by fetching execution traces from LangSmith Studio. Use when debugging agent behavior, investigating errors, analyzing tool calls, checking memory operations, or examining agent performance. Automatically fetches recent traces and analyzes execution patterns. Requires langsmith-fetch CLI installed.
